Notes |
Pair of green chintz curtains which were brought to N.Z. circa 1823, by Mary Ann Williams (Mrs. James Preece, Church Missionary Society) and which had belonged to her mother" (ocm) Drapes brought from England to NSW in 1828 and to New Zealand in 1831. They were originally owned by Mrs Jane White (Mary Ann Preece's mother) and were drapes for a 4-poster bed. See notes by Marnie Spicer Mary Ann Williams left Bristol with mother and step-sister in 1828; arrived Parramatta 1829; worked as Matron School of Industry for circa 3 years; then recruited by CMS (Marsden or Yates) to work at as assistant at CMS girls school Paihia – later transferred to Kerikeri and following marriage to James Preece in January 1833, transferred to Waimate. Mary Ann Williams brought these curtains, which had belonged to her mother, to New Zealand when she emigrated. Mary Ann Williams had married James Preece, a fellow missionary at Kerikeri on 25 January 1833. Mary Ann and James opened mission stations at Puriri and Parawai near Thames, at Ahikereru in the Urewera mountains and at Whakatane. |
